Our review of the Fox Racing Men's Dirtpaw Motocross Dirt Bike Glove finds it best suited for riders who want durable protection with strong lever feel and touchscreen convenience. The single biggest reason to buy is the combination of a padded Clarino palm and silicone fingertip print that deliver confident grip and control during aggressive shifts and braking. The gloves strike a practical balance of protection, dexterity and comfort thanks to compression-molded neoprene cuffs and stretch mesh gussets that keep fingers mobile while offering knuckle coverage.
Key Features
- Padded Clarino palm: a single-layer conductive Clarino palm provides cushioning and lets you use a touchscreen without removing the glove.
- Silicone fingertip print: printed silicone on the fingertips improves lever grip and reduces slipping under wet or muddy conditions.
- Direct inject TPR knuckle coverage: durable top-of-hand nylon with injected TPR adds impact protection where riders need it most.
- Compression-molded cuff: the neoprene cuff offers a secure, locked-in fit that helps keep debris out during rides.
- Breathable stretch mesh: finger gussets increase airflow and dexterity so riders can maintain control on long runs.
Who It's For
These gloves are aimed at motocross and off-road riders who value tactile feedback and grip for racing or trail riding. The Clarino palm and silicone print particularly benefit riders who need consistent lever feel and want the convenience of touchscreen compatibility for navigation devices or phones.
Riders who need heavy-duty climate insulation or full gauntlet-style race gloves with extended wrist coverage should look elsewhere, as these are midweight gloves focused on dexterity and protection rather than thermal warmth or extended cuff sealing.

Specifications
| Brand | Fox Racing |
| Model | Dirtpaw Motocross Dirt Bike Glove |
| Materials | 52% polyamide nylon, 20% neoprene, 9% polyvinyl chloride, 9% polyurethane, 6% elastane, 4% polyester |
| Palm | Padded single-layer conductive Clarino (touch screen compatible) |
| Cuff | Compression-molded neoprene cuff for a secure fit |
| Protection | Direct inject TPR knuckle coverage |
| Grip | Silicone print at fingertips for lever grip |
